>> I did consider this, though the issue is what do I do with the existing NT4
>> PDC - I can demote this to BDC but from the samba docs samba PDC and Windows
>> BDC is not supported.  And I don't think it can demote the PDC to server
>> role.
> 
> There is no supported NT4 PDC demotion scenario. But via registry hack
> I think you can demote to server and then become a member server. And
> Exchange 5.5 can run on member server.

for info
long time ago i tested exchange 5.5 / win2000 server working with a
samba pdc controller
it worked like charme, but thats years ago

these days you shouldnt use such setups, there are a lot of other
solutions, based on open source or ms solutions
exchange 5.5 is too much outdated
